Output 686453cf186c90b60dce4a3ed1020c9248b6fa5f4a01310d7cc7f37c175237ac:0

value
3531650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ac3ad333300dd51b34ca3320d130b561318f8b2 OP_EQUAL
address
3JiY2529qQFDbh6cjoAdFDj2A4TzUmpCfq
transaction
686453cf186c90b60dce4a3ed1020c9248b6fa5f4a01310d7cc7f37c175237ac
spent
true